The 4 Humors are the four main aspects to a person’s health… according to old-timey (like majorly old-timey… like middle ages old-timey) “physicians.” If (1) blood, (2) yellow bile, (3) black bile, and (4) phlegm were in balance within your body, you were healthy. If one is in excess you’ll fall ill. We now know that human beings are much more complicated than this, but the 4 Humors remain an accurate, although admittedly gross, way to describe the main characters in any tv cast.
At some point the 4 Humors became the 4 Temperaments, with personality types taking form out of what the imbalance of a Humour would manifest as. “Blood” became a “Sanguine” personality, outgoing & emotional. “Yellow Bile” became “Choleric”, removed & focused. “Black Bile” became the “Melancholic” personality, faithful & practical. And “Phlegm” became “Phlegmatic”, calm & thoughtful. That can be quite confusing so let me put it in a form that we all know: the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les. There is another alternative however. Sometimes, when you have more than 4 characters one is Leukine. Leukine is a personality that doesn’t fit the stereotypes of the 4 Temperaments. These characters tend to be more balance, making them more stable people… but also usually less entertaining to watch.
